Description
A collection of DVDs all gathered into one "binge box" for a spectacular movie night. Titles include: Castle in the sky ; Howl's moving castle ; Kiki's delivery service ; My neighbor Totoro ; Ponyo ; Spirited away.
Castle in the Sky (1986): Pazu is an engineer's apprentice who finds Sheeta, a young girl, floating down from the sky, wearing a glowing pendant. Together, they discover both are searching for Laputa, a legendary floating castle, and vow to unravel the mystery of the luminous crystal around Sheeta's neck. Their quest won't be easy. There are greedy air pirates, secret government agents and astounding obstacles to keep them from learning the truth.
Howl's Moving Castle (2004): Sophie, a quiet girl working in a hat shop, finds her life thrown into turmoil when she is literally swept off her feet by a handsome but mysterious wizard named Howl. The vengeful Witch of the Waste, jealous of their friendship, puts a spell on Sophie. In a life changing adventure, Sophie climbs aboard Howl's magnificent moving castle and enters a magical world on a quest to break the spell.
Kiki's Delivery Service (1989): Kiki is an enterprising young girl who must follow tradition to become a full fledged witch. Venturing out with only her black cat, Jiji, Kiki flies off for the adventure of a lifetime. Landing in a far off city, she sets up a high flying delivery service and begins a wonderful experience of independence and responsibility as she finds her place in the world.
My Neighbor Totoro (1988): After moving to the country to be near their ailing mother, two young sisters are befriended by a variety of mysterious creatures.
Ponyo (2008): A young boy named Sosuke rescues a goldfish named Ponyo, and they embark on a fantastic journey of friendship and discovery before Ponyo's father, a powerful sorcerer, forces her to return to her home in the sea. Ponyo's desire to be human upsets the delicate balance of nature and triggers a gigantic storm. Only Ponyo's mother, a beautiful sea goddess, can restore nature's balance and make Ponyo's dreams come true.
Spirited Away (2001): Chihiro and her parents accidentally wander into another world ruled by witches and monsters. When her parents are captured by the ruler of the world, she tricks the witch into hiring her so she can figure out how to free them.
